Officially it's Reick. At least according to his best times at training. If he was still in first grade, it would be Joven Clarke.


But you've got to wonder what good it is having a great time at training if you can't pull it out come game day. Some examples- last year, Justin Murphy scored a 90 metre try, running straight past Rieck who couldn't make up any ground on him. What about Ryan Cross?? Apparently he is one of the fastest in the comp, but when he made an intercept against Newcastle last weekend he got run down. Ditto Elford from the Tigers, he has great times as well, but when he made an intercept against the Warriors they were coming from all angles to run him down, and the Warriors don't have any noted speedsters.

Matt Cooper is another one of the fastest, has a time of 10.7 over the 100m as well.
